Engineered to meet the exact performance standards of the 2010–2023 Yellowfin 21 Bay-Hybrid, this 50-gallon replacement fuel tank is the ultimate solution for a seamless "one-and-done" restoration. This unit is precision-designed to fit perfectly within the original stringer grid, ensuring your vessel maintains the factory-specified weight distribution and shallow-draft capabilities essential for elite bay boat performance. To provide a massive upgrade in longevity, the entire tank is encapsulated in a high-build Coal Tar Epoxy shield, creating a permanent moisture barrier that prevents corrosion in foamed-in hull environments. This drop-in replacement aligns perfectly with all factory fill, vent, and pickup locations, offering a rugged, long-term upgrade that far outlasts standard aluminum alternatives.

 

  • Guaranteed to Fit Your Yellowfin
    Every tank is engineered using OEM drawings and/or reverse-engineered from an original unit to ensure a precise, 100% guaranteed fit.  

 

  • Fully Certified Manufacturing
    Our tanks are built by an NMMA-type certified manufacturer and produced in accordance with all ABYC standards.

 

  • USCG Compliant & Pressure Tested
    Each tank meets all USCG requirements and is individually pressure-tested in house. All federal regulations are followed throughout our manufacturing process to ensure maximum safety and reliability.

 

  • .125-Thickness 5052 H32 Aluminum Construction
    Built from premium marine-grade 5052 H32 aluminum at .125 thickness for exceptional strength and long-term durability.

 

  • Complete, Ready-to-Install System
    Each tank comes fully equipped with all required components, including the sender, fittings, and hardware.

 

  • Precision Hand-Welded Construction
    Every tank is hand-crafted using GTAW (TIG) welding, exceeding ASME and AWS D3.7:2004 standards for marine aluminum fabrication.
                                                   

 

  • Sherwin-Williams® TarGard® Epoxy Coating
    Finished with Sherwin-Williams® TarGard® Epoxy to provide added protection against corrosion and harsh marine environments, extending the overall life of the tank.

 

  • KUS® (formerly WEMA USA®) Reed-Switch Fuel Level Sender
    Features a high-quality KUS® reed-switch sender with an NBR float, providing accurate and reliable fuel-level measurement.
